The 14th annual Associated Electric Cooperative Charity Tournament benefits the Springfield Workshop, the areas sheltered workshop. This is the 14th year for the Tournament and we have really made it special! This year we are moving the tournament to The Presitgious Hickory Hills County Club.
In addition to the new venue, There are lots of fun games to play, an incredible dinner to enjoy following the Tournament and did we mention the outstanding live and silent auctions plus the Day Spa? Without a doubt, this is THE golf tournament to attend!
Proceeds from this year’s event will go toward development of some very special projects that will create a full service cafeteria for the employees, a greenhouse to grow vegetables for the cafeteria and sell to the public and classroom space for wellness and life skills classes! Help some special employees get in the game!
Instead of sponsoring the usual hole or a cart, how about sponsoring a Springfield Workshop employee as a “Workshop Player” instead? Because of their disabilities, the majority of our employees are not able to enjoy the game of golf, so we created a way for them to be a part of the fun and excitement anyway! Each sponsored Workshop Player will have their name and their sponsor placed on a sign at a hole on the course. The Workshop Player will be entered into a drawing for some great prizes like a flat screen TV, a Nintendo Wii or an IPod Touch! It’s like sponsoring a hole, but a Whole lot nicer!
